As a worker on a container ship, boat, fishing boat, cruise ship, charter boat, or any other kinds of ship vessel, it is highly probable that you are covered under the Merchant Marine Act. Even those employees who are working in offshore rigs and any other places in or near the water are also covered by this ruling.

Known as the “trio” of the federal law, it fundamentally states that all merchandises and goods transported through water between the US ports must be accomplished with the use of flag ships from the United States. These vessels must be made in the United States as well as owned by United States’ citizens and operated by crews with US citizenship. They should also comply with the law pertaining to the United States’ agricultural interests and merchant marine industry.
